💙 Lead the Future of Cardiac Sonography Education at CHCP

Are you a seasoned cardiac sonography professional ready to step into a leadership role and make a lasting impact?

At CHCP (The College of Health Care Professions), we’re seeking a Program Director – Cardiac Sonography (Echocardiography) to lead, innovate, and elevate our program in Austin, TX.

In this role, you’ll drive program excellence, faculty development, and student success, while ensuring alignment with accreditation standards and evolving healthcare industry needs.


✨ What You’ll Do
  • Lead and manage all aspects of the Echocardiography program, including curriculum, faculty, and operations

  • Supervise and support instructional staff across classroom and clinical environments

  • Drive continuous program improvement through planning, evaluation, and innovation

  • Ensure compliance with institutional, state, federal, and accreditation standards

  • Collaborate with campus leadership to improve student outcomes, completion rates, and job placement

  • Facilitate advisory board meetings to maintain industry alignment and relevance

  • Recruit, interview, and onboard faculty aligned with program goals

  • Support student recruitment and retention efforts

  • Oversee student orientation and faculty training initiatives

  • Partner with administration to maintain accurate academic records and program documentation


🎓 What We’re Looking For

  • Bachelor’s degree (required)

  • Minimum of 3 years of teaching or occupational experience in cardiac sonography or a related field

  • At least 2 years of full-time experience as a registered sonographer

  • Proven experience in curriculum development and program assessment

  • Strong knowledge of accreditation and regulatory requirements

  • Certified, registered, and/or licensed in cardiac sonography or a related field
